Transaction 8d62dfb79f128aab770cf502120d022cd1be751ec1519c514ee5ea38d36ebf32

1 Input
2 Outputs
  • 8d62dfb79f128aab770cf502120d022cd1be751ec1519c514ee5ea38d36ebf32:0
  • value  605546
    address  3AEAyfEFDsS95En8jPbFdkqc8nDeFWXmLZ
  • 8d62dfb79f128aab770cf502120d022cd1be751ec1519c514ee5ea38d36ebf32:1
  • value  51670280
    address  32QwyaNLMSMaGjJpHwNEFeE9oTKCRcFQxv